I want a module level initialised delegate. if I try module foo; enum Status { success, } class StatusException : Exception { Status s; // usual exception constructors } void delegate(Status) onError = (Status s) { throw new StatusException(s);}; I get a error like cannot initialise something that needs a context at compile time. Ignoring the fact the the initialiser does not need a context, if I do void delegate(Status) onError; static this() { onError = (Status s) { throw new StatusException(s);}; } void main() { import std.stdio; writeln(onError.funcptr); // null } WAT? void delegate(Status) onError; static this() { import core.stdc.stdio; printf("initialising onError"); onError = (Status s) { throw new StatusException(s);}; printf("initialising onError: funcptr = 0x%x", onError.funcptr); } void main() { import std.stdio; writeln(onError.funcptr); } output: null No "initialising onError", the static this is not even being run! I'm using LDC master. See also https://github.com/libmir/dcompute/issues/32

On Saturday, 30 September 2017 at 06:15:41 UTC, Nicholas Wilson wrote:No "initialising onError", the static this is not even being run! I'm using LDC master. See also https://github.com/libmir/dcompute/issues/32LDC 1.4, DMD 2.076, DMD ~master and finally GDC all give the expected result here "initialising onErrorinitialising onError: funcptr = 0x<some address>" each time using: --- enum Status {success,} class StatusException : Exception { this(Status s) {this.s = s;super("");} Status s; } void delegate(Status) onError; static this() { import core.stdc.stdio; printf("initialising onError"); onError = (Status s) { throw new StatusException(s);}; printf("initialising onError: funcptr = 0x%x", onError.funcptr); } void main() { import std.stdio; writeln(onError.funcptr); } ---
